Got a 90 reg TT with JDM brain and profec B 11. prob is engine keeps flooding and am fed up with taking plugs out and having to dry them before car will start!!

Also the electric fan has started to come on all the time today!!

Is the sensor for this the one next to temp gauge sensor because it doesnt make a difference to the fan if i unplug it :confused:

 

Paul.

Featured Replies

Paul,

 

You are correct, the two pin plug ( yellow) is the engine temperature sensor, a poor or broken connection here will give a corrupted signal to the ecu fooling it in to overheat protection mode, this increases tick over slightly powers up the air condensor fan and overfuels the engine, all of this is aimed at cooling an overheating engine.

 

Of course your engine is not overheating so it just floods the plugs, disconnecting the sensor will have the same effect, what you need to do is clean up the connection with WD40 or somthing similar and clean with the end of a craft knife or similar, closing the connector up slightly too will give a better connection.

 

Hope that helps
